7 Spring Activities to Make Memories with Your Kids.



Spring garden

Say goodbye to the chilly winter months and hello to the glorious arrival of spring! It's that magical time of year when nature bursts into bloom, and the world becomes a playground of endless possibilities. And what better way to celebrate than by diving headfirst into a whirlwind of Spring fun and adventure with your little ones? Springtime is all about laughter, exploration, and creating unforgettable memories with your family. So, grab your sun hats and let's embark on a journey of joy and discovery with these 7 spring activities for kids!"

1. Inspire a Budding Young Gardener Get ready to cultivate a little green thumb with your kiddos! Springtime is bursting with excitement, making it the ideal season to introduce young children to the joy of gardening. It's a season of growth where little ones can witness the thrill of seeds bursting into life, flowers blooming, and vegetables flourishing. Planting seeds isn’t just about gardening: it's a lesson in patience, care, responsibility, and the wonders of nature. As tiny seeds are gently tucked into the soil, young minds are filled with wonder and excitement for the promise of new life. With love and care, they’ll water, nurture, and cheer on their little plant pals as they grow and thrive. Gardening isn’t just a hobby – it’s a joyful adventure that connect us to the beauty of the natural world.

2. Nature Journaling - A timeless practice that invites children to dive headfirst into the thrilling wonders of the great outdoors! As they jot down their discoveries, young adventurers get a front row seat to Mother Nature’s marvellous transformations, from the vibrant blooms of spring to the golden glow of autumn foliage. Encourage them to jazz up their journals with sketches, pressed flowers, leaf rubbings, insects they’ve spotted and giggly tales of the season’s best bits. By flipping through their journals, they uncover the seasonal changes, patterns in plant growth, animal antics, and wild weather twists and turns. This exploration bonds them closer to nature, and sparks a wild love for each season’s unique delights.





3. Playful Picnics – Let’s take a moment to talk about picnics – they’re an absolute blast for young kids, whether they’re out in nature or happening right in the playroom! Outdoors under the warm sun, kids can bounce around, explore, whilst having the time of their lives. Add delicious sandwiches, and snacks into the mix and you have a recipe for a memory they’ll cherish forever. And who says the fun needs to stop when spring showers are forecast? Indoors, it’s all about turning the playroom into a magical picnic wonderland. Layer cozy blankets and pillows on the floor to create a comfortable cozy place to sit. Serve a variety of finger foods, homemade treats and play their favourite music to transform an everyday space into a whimsical adventure.

4. Outdoor Storytime - With leaves rustling above and birds chirping cheerfully, stories burst into life under the open sky. The outdoor setting adds magic to storytelling, fostering a love for both literature and nature. Choose your favourite tales or take a trip to your local library to start your adventure. Pack a picnic blanket and a handful of snacks and have yourself a seasonal storytime within the magic of the outdoors.

5. Garden Obstacle Course - Welcome to the Garden Obstacle Extravaganza! Get ready to transform your garden into the ultimate playground of excitement and adventure! Children dashing through a set of playful challenges, leaping over stepping stones, weaving through hula hoops, carefully balancing a ball on a tennis racket and tiptoeing along planks of wood all whilst trying to beat their best time!

With each hurdle conquered, they’re not just having fun, they’re refining their motor skills, balance and coordination, building camaraderie as they cheer on each family member. So come join the Garden Obstacle Extravaganza where triumphs are celebrated with high fives and hugs.

6. Sunshine Sizzle - Cooking up breakfast outdoors with the little ones is a feast for their senses – imagine the moment when their little eyes flutter open, still sleepy from dreamland. As they rub their eyes and stretch their arms, a delicious surprise awaits: the mouthwatering scent of breakfast cooking but the kitchen is empty! As they step outside their sleepy yawns turn to wide-eyed wonder as they discover their al fresco feast awaits. Outdoor meals spark curiosity, and a simple breakfast of pancakes or sausage and eggs cooked on a bbq or over an open fire with children transforms mealtime into a thrilling adventure. They eagerly dive right in, cracking eggs, flipping sausages, and mastering basic cooking skills. And let’s not forget the sensory delight that comes with dining outdoors. Food always tastes better when cooked and enjoyed in the fresh air thanks to the heightened sensory experience!




7. Starry Night Adventure - Create a magical adventure that transports children into the realm of nature's wonder – right in their own back garden! Toasting marshmallows over a crackling fire, giggling at torch light animations, snuggling together to keep warm. A back garden campout is all about convivence and closeness. No need to pack the car or plan a big trip – just pitch up your tent on the lawn, grab your sleeping bag and snuggle up under the star-studded sky. Bedtime storing under twinkling stars become legendary tales and the memories they make will last a lifetime.
